I’m Irakli, the solo builder behind Briefing Fox.
Over the past year I spent a lot of time experimenting with AI tools like ChatGPT and Gemini. One thing kept bothering me: people say AI is powerful, but in practice many of us still struggle to make it actually useful for real work.
At first I thought the problem was prompting. But after watching how people use AI (and using it myself), I realized something else.
Most of the time we start with very vague goals.
We type something like:
“Create a strategy”,
“Help me with marketing”,
“Plan this project”.
But in reality those tasks require context, constraints, priorities, and clear objectives. Humans need that kind of briefing to do good work — and AI does too.
That’s the idea behind Briefing Fox.
Instead of chatting with AI right away, the tool helps you clarify your goal first. It asks a few focused questions and turns your idea into a structured brief that AI can actually execute.
It works especially well for more complex things like:
• business ideas
• marketing strategies
• research projects
• planning and decision making
